#611586 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#611586 is composed of 38% red, 8.2% green and 52.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 27.6% cyan, 84.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 47.5% black. It has a hue angle of 280.4 degrees, a saturation of 72.9% and a lightness of 30.4%. #611586 color hex could be obtained by blending #c22aff with #00000d. Closest websafe color is: #660099.

#611586 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#611586 has RGB values of R:97, G:21, B:134 and CMYK values of C:0.28, M:0.84, Y:0, K:0.47. Its decimal value is 6362502.
